組件化向Spec Repo提交podspec時:
報錯:
Your configuration specifies to merge with the ref 'refs/heads/master' from the remote, but no such ref was fetched
之前沒遇到過,找了一堆資料,解決辦法都不行,最后找到原因:
創建私有Spec Repo時,我們公司使用的是GitLab, 新建項目時:
WechatIMG885.png
沒有勾選這一欄,造成倉庫內是空的
解決辦法:
克隆下來Repo倉庫地址,向倉庫里面傳一個文件就行了(隨便一個不使用的文件),再次:
pod repo push xxx xxx.podspec
就沒問題了